Moderators Andavari Posted March 19, 2008 Moderators Share Posted March 19, 2008 You didn't by chance install the newest version over a previously installed version did you? If so you should do what's recommended via the SpywareBlaster knowledge base article and do a clean install of SpywareBlaster as detailed here. You could use Disable All Protection, then hit Enable All Protection. Other than that I can think of: Perhaps you need to be logged in as the Admin if you already aren't. If you're using Spybot-S&D perhaps it's Immunization is doing something to conflict. Maybe a registry permissions problem which Dial-a-fix (link in my sig) may be able to fix. Well , it is related to the spy ware doctor anti spy immunization .I checked by pressing the immunization button off and on ,and every time it made changes in the spy ware blaster as described before . In view of the fact that the two anti spy clash in that matter ,then what should I do ?
